Sinking In
Battling a sink obstruction automatically implies obtaining a washroom plunger. In picking a bettor, see to it it has a large enough suction cup that can totally hide the drain. It ought to likewise have the ability to develop an airtight seal around the surrounding sink. Next, you must load the component to entirely cover the plunger's suction cup. Do this by using water or finish the mug's edge with oil jelly. You should create a vacuum by trying to seal various other electrical outlets, like overflow drainpipe in sinks. After that, push out any trapped air underneath the cup. After this, do 15 to 20 powerful up-and-down pumping strikes to snag loosened the obstruction. It might take you 3 to 5 times of this cycle to do the method. Serpent It Out If using the plunger doesn't work, then you would have to resort to another technique. In this remedy, you would need to have a plumbing snake. You can get one at your local hardware. These can work their way through your drain pipes and physically push out the clogs. Plumbing snakes are considered to be one of the most reputable devices for dealing with water drainage troubles. All you need to do is press the snake in up until you hit the blockage. Once you hit the clog, hook it up by twisting your serpent's take care of. After hooking it up, press your snake back and forth until you really feel that the blockage has broken up. After that, clear out the pipeline using cold water. Main Drainpipe Clean-up If you discover that more than one of your draining pipes components is clogged up, then your major drain line might be the issue. Thus, you need to clean it up. You can start by locating the clean-out plugs of the huge drainpipe pipes. You can find these in your crawlspace or cellar. Key drain lines can also be located in your garage or someplace outside, along the foundations of your residence. You can see that each plug has a cap on it that has a square installation on the top. Utilize a wrench to remove the cap. See to it that you have a pail with you to catch some dripping water. Additionally, make sure that nobody will certainly utilize the facilities while you the main drainpipe line is open, or else some serious trouble can come your method. Once you have every little thing in place, use a plumbing serpent to break up any blockages in the main line by running the snake in all instructions of the pipeline.
Be Vigilant
One way to deal with major plumbing problems is by avoidance. Keeping an eagle eye for slow or slow drains pipes is the key. It is way a lot easier to repair and unblock a slow drainpipe than opening one that has actually completely quit from working. If your drain is sluggish, you can fix this by just pouring hot water down the pipeline. Do this to loosen any kind of grease build-up. Additionally, you need to clean up the drainpipe screen or stopper. This need to work. Nonetheless, if it doesn't, after that try to find the problem by taking a look at other family drains. Do this to understand whether the obstruction is present in just one fixture. If it ends up that other drains are obstructed, then you might have a problem with your primary drainpipe pipe.

Dispose of Leftovers Properly
Another common issue during the holidays is drains getting clogged with food scraps. To avoid this, dispose of all food properly in the garbage or keep leftovers in the fridge. A few foods that you should never let go down your drain or garbage disposal include:

Taking too many showers in a short period of time can lead to decreased water pressure and lukewarm to cold water temperatures. If you have several family members or friends staying with you during the holidays, make sure to space out showers to avoid any problems and give your water heater time to replenish.
Take Care of Your Toilet
The toilet is one of the most used plumbing fixtures in the home, so it’s important to take care of it, especially during the holidays. One of the last things anyone wants to deal with during a holiday dinner is a clogged toilet, so make sure your guests know not to treat your toilet like a trash can. Avoid flushing anything other than human waste and toilet paper down the toilet.
